A Windows 10 v1703 (Creators Update) bevezet egy új konzol segédprogramot mbr2gpt.exe, amely lehetővé teszi egy MBR (Master Boot Record) partíciós táblával rendelkező lemez GPT-re (GUID partíciós tábla) konvertálását anélkül, hogy adatvesztést és partíciókat törölne a lemezről. A segédprogram képes konvertálni a rendszerlemezt, amelyre a Windows telepítve van, és az adatlemezt. A segédprogram felhasználható a partíciós tábla konvertálására mind a Windows PE (Windows Preinstallation Environment) rendszerben, beleértve a frissítés mindkét részét a Windows 7-ről Windows 10-re, és közvetlenül a Windows 10-re.
Az Mbr2gpt lehetővé teszi a partíciós tábla konvertálását MBR-ből GPT-re a Windows 10 1507, 1511 és v1607 verziókban (feltéve, hogy offline konvertálást végez a Windows 10 1703 képről). Az operációs rendszer korábbi verziói (Windows 7, Windows 8 és Windows 8.1) nem hivatalosan támogatottak.
megjegyzés. Korábban egy harmadik féltől származó gptgen segédprogrammal konvertálhatott egy nem rendszerlemezt MBR-ből GPT-re partíciók elvesztése nélkül. A rendszerlemez konvertálásához meg kell formázni.Az Mbr2gpt segédprogram logikája, amikor egy lemezt MBR-ről GPT-re konvertálnak, a következők:
- Lemez ellenőrzése
- Ha a lemezen nincs EFI rendszerpartíció (ESP), akkor az egyik partíció szabad helyének köszönhetően jön létre.
- Az UEFI rendszerindító fájljait átmásolják az ESP partícióra
- GPT metaadatok alkalmazva
- Frissítse a BCD rendszerindító fájlt
Mint láthatja, a meglévő partíciók adatait ez nem érinti.
Az MBR2GPT segédprogram a következő szintaxissal rendelkezik:
mbr2gpt / érvényesítés | konvertálás [/ lemez:] [/ naplók:] [/ térkép: =] [/ allowFullOS]
- /validate - csak a lemezt ellenőrzik a partíciós tábla konvertálásának lehetősége szempontjából (beleértve annak ellenőrzését is, hogy van-e elegendő hely a GPT fő és másodlagos tábláinak tárolására: 16Kb + 2 szektorok a lemez elején és 16Kb + 1 szektorok a végén)
- / convert - indítsa el a lemezkonverziót a sikeres érvényesítés függvényében
- /tárcsa: - beállítja a GPT-re konvertálandó lemezszámot. Ha a szám nincs beállítva, akkor a rendszerlemez átalakítását kell elvégezni (hasonlóan a Diskparthoz: válassza ki a lemezrendszer parancsát)
- /rönk: - azt a könyvtár elérési útját jelzi, ahol az MBR2GPT segédprogramnak naplókat kell írnia. Ha nincs megadva elérési út, akkor a% windir% könyvtárat kell használni. Naplófájlok: diagerr.xml, diagwrn.xml, setuperr.log és setupact.log
- / térkép: = lehetővé teszi további partíciós táblázatok leképezésének megadását az MBR és a GPT között. Például / térkép: 42 = af9b60a0-1431-4f62-bc68-3311714a69ad. Az MBR szakasz számát a decimális rendszer írja le, és a GPT GUID határolókat tartalmaz. Megadhat több ilyen leképezést.
- /allowFullOS - alapértelmezés szerint az MBR2GPT segédprogram csak a Windows PE futási idején fut. Ezzel a gombbal engedélyezheti a segédprogram futtatását teljes Windows környezetben
Futtasson például egy tesztet a jelenlegi rendszer MBR lemezének GPT-re konvertálására.
mbr2gpt.exe / lemez: 0 / érvényesítés / Naplók: C: \ naplók / allowFullOS
sor MBR2GPT: érvényesítés befejezték sikeresen jelzi, hogy ilyen átalakítás elvégezhető.
tanács. Ha a rendszermeghajtó a BitLocker használatával van titkosítva, akkor a partíció konvertálása előtt vissza kell dekódolnia.Futtassa a konverziót:
mbr2gpt.exe / convert / disk: 0
Az MBR2GPT megpróbálja konvertálni a 0. lemezt.
Ha a konvertálás sikeres, akkor a lemezt csak GPT módban lehet indítani.
Ezeket a változásokat nem lehet visszavonni!
MBR2GPT: A 0. lemez konvertálására tett kísérlet
MBR2GPT: A lemez elrendezésének beolvasása
MBR2GPT: Érvényes elrendezés, a lemez szektor mérete: 512 bájt
MBR2GPT: Megpróbálom összecsukni a rendszerpartíciót
MBR2GPT: Megpróbálom összecsukni az operációs rendszer partícióját
MBR2GPT: EFI rendszerpartíció létrehozása
MBR2GPT: Az új indító fájlok telepítése
MBR2GPT: Az elrendezés konvertálása
MBR2GPT: Az alapértelmezett rendszerindító bejegyzés migrálása
MBR2GPT: Helyreállítási rendszerindító bejegyzés hozzáadása
MBR2GPT: A meghajtó betűleképezésének javítása
MBR2GPT: A konverzió sikeresen befejeződött
MBR2GPT: Mielőtt az új rendszer megfelelően elindulna, át kell állítania a firmware-t UEFI módba!
Annak érdekében, hogy a számítógép az új EFI partícióról indulhasson, újra kell konfigurálnia a számítógépet, hogy UEFI módban induljon. Indítsa újra a számítógépet az UEFI beállításokban, váltson a Legacy boot mode (BIOS) UEFI (Pure) értékre, és mentse el a módosításokat.
A Windows 10 sikeresen indul. Az msinfo32.exe segédprogrammal ellenőrizheti, hogy a Windows 10 rendszer UEFI módban indul-e.
Az UEFI használatakor a felhasználók kihasználhatják a következő előnyöket:
- képesség 2 Tb-nél nagyobb partíciók létrehozására
- Biztonságos rendszerindítási környezet a Biztonságos Rendszerindítással
- technológia a rosszindulatú programok elleni védelem korai elindításához - ELAM (Early Launch Antimalware)
- Készülékőr és Kreatív őr a Windows 10 Enterprise rendszeren
- biztonságos indítás (Mért boot)